“Although very last minute and only one night there my kids enjoyed every moment of the campsite and state park. The tentrr tents were very comfortable and nicely set up. A few things to note- Bring your own fire wood and a ton of extra ice. Bring a large cooler to keep food in or keep in your vehicle at all times. Any and all items need to be put into a dry storage area after dark. Those pesky, and also extremely cute and friendly raccoons will steal anything left out.. including shoes, lol. Something to kill fire ants as well. All in all I give it 5 stars.”

“Good site! Especially for the 2 tents. We had the privacy in between the 2 tents which worked out really well. There is definitely enough space for the pop up tent, if you had more people. The Tentrr canvas tent is big enough to fit another queen air mattress. We didn't need the propane heater. The canvas tent and bed were quite comfy. Zach was very helpful and even got us some water! The only drawback was that we were far away from the bathrooms. It's a bit of a walk. But the bathrooms and showers are very clean. Oh! And the trains! There is a train track close by. 2am and 3am passing by. But otherwise very clean and felt very safe. Loved the convenience of not pitching the tent. And sleeping on a bed. And the fire put and chairs were awesome!! We will definitely be checking out the other Tentrr sites! Awesome experience!”
